Hanging Plant Ladder

Hanging plants with wooden sticks and planters
Source: Pinterest

I adore a vertical plant display because it brings life up the wall without taking floor space, and this one with wooden sticks feels so naturally boho. When I first tried a hanging planter ladder in my studio it made the whole room feel taller and fresher. You can mix trailing pothos with a few small succulents for texture, and the wooden rods add that warm, handmade vibe. If you’re worried about watering mess, line the planters with small saucers and you will be fine.

How to Actually Make This Work For You

How do I choose the right wall for boho decor?

Pick a wall that you see often, like above the sofa or bed, so your efforts get daily enjoyment – a piece that faces natural light usually looks best. Consider sightlines from the door and how the decor balances with furniture, and don’t be afraid to start small on a narrow wall to practice.

Can I mix modern pieces with boho items?

Yes, mixing modern and boho creates a balanced, collected feel that reads current and personal – I pair a sleek lamp with woven art frequently. Keep color temperature consistent and repeat materials like wood or rattan to make the mix feel cohesive.

What materials should I use for a true boho vibe?

Focus on natural textures like wood, rattan, woven fibers, dried flowers, and linen to get that warm, grounded boho look – these materials age beautifully and add depth. Add metal or glass sparingly for contrast so the space doesn’t feel too rustic.

How can I hang delicate pieces without damage?

Use removable hooks and lightweight frames for delicate items and consider clear picture hanging strips to avoid holes – they hold surprisingly well for art and small hangings. For heavier items like driftwood or large mirrors use proper anchors and studs to keep everything secure.
